Understanding Bread Lames: An Essential Tool for Bakers

What is a Bread Lame?

A bread lame, also known as a dough lame or scoring knife, is a razor-sharp blade attached to a wooden or plastic handle. It is designed specifically for scoring the surface of bread dough before baking. Scoring serves several essential purposes:

  • Controlled Expansion: Scoring allows the dough to expand evenly in the oven, preventing it from tearing or bursting during baking.
  • Crust Character: The score lines create a predetermined path for the bread to rise, forming a uniform crust with desired texture and shape.
  • Aesthetics: Scoring adds visual appeal to the bread, creating attractive and decorative patterns on the crust.

Types of Bread Lames

Bread lames come in various shapes and sizes, each designed for specific scoring techniques. The most common types include:

  • Straight Lame: A straight blade with a pointed tip, ideal for making precise and shallow cuts.
  • Curved Lame: A curved blade that allows for smoother, more curved strokes for decorative scoring.
  • Double-Edged Lame: A lame with two razor-sharp edges, enabling both straight and curved scoring.

Preparing Dough for Scoring: Optimal Hydration and Temperature

Scoring bread dough is crucial for achieving the perfect crust and crumb structure. Dough hydration and temperature play a significant role in determining the effectiveness of scoring. Here’s how to optimize these factors to ensure optimal bread scoring results:

Optimal Hydration

The dough’s hydration level is expressed as a percentage of water to flour weight. Ideal hydration levels for scoring bread vary based on the type of bread you’re making. Generally, a hydration level between 65% to 75% is suitable for scoring.

Higher hydration levels make the dough more elastic, allowing for deeper and more pronounced scoring. However, excessively wet dough can be difficult to handle and score effectively, resulting in tearing or uneven cuts.

Optimal Temperature

The temperature of the dough before scoring also affects its scoring properties. Dough that is too cold will be stiff and difficult to score, while dough that is too warm will be sticky and prone to tearing.

The ideal dough temperature for scoring is around 75-80°F (24-27°C). This temperature allows the dough to be pliable enough for precise scoring without being overly sticky or stiff.

Positioning the Bread Lame: Creating Accurate and Clean Cuts

Proper placement of the bread lame is crucial for creating precise and aesthetically pleasing cuts. Follow these steps to ensure optimal results:

  1. Choose a Sharp Lame: Use a well-sharpened lame for clean and accurate cuts.
  2. Determine the Desired Angle: The angle of the cut will dictate the shape and appearance of the bread. For a traditional slash, hold the lame at a 45-degree angle to the work surface.
  3. Secure the Lame: Hold the lame firmly and use your dominant hand to guide the blade. Rest your non-dominant hand on the loaf for stability.
  4. Make a Confident Cut: Apply even pressure and draw the lame through the dough in a single, swift motion. Avoid hesitating or sawing, as this can tear the bread.

Tips for Clean and Accurate Cuts:

  • Practice on a spare piece of dough to get a feel for the lame’s movement.
  • Score the dough deeply enough to ensure a nice ear, but avoid cutting too deeply into the bread.
  • Keep the lame clean and free of sticky dough to prevent tearing.

Ensuring Proper Depth of Scoring: Enhancing Dough Expansion

Scoring, the art of slicing the surface of the dough just before baking, plays a crucial role in the expansion and shaping of the loaf. Scoring the dough properly allows for controlled expansion, enabling it to attain its optimal height and structure.

In order to achieve the desired effect, it’s essential to score the dough to the correct depth. Scoring too shallowly will limit expansion, resulting in a flatter loaf with a dense crumb. Conversely, scoring too deeply can cause the loaf to tear and collapse during baking.

Determining Optimal Scoring Depth

The appropriate scoring depth depends on several factors, including the type of dough, its hydration level, and the desired loaf shape.

As a general guideline, aim for a depth of about 1/4 to 1/2 inch. For highly hydrated doughs, which are more likely to spread, you may want to score slightly deeper. Conversely, for stiffer doughs, a shallower score will suffice.

Scoring Techniques for Controlled Expansion

In addition to depth, the scoring technique itself can influence the expansion of the dough. Here are some effective techniques:

  • Straight Scoring: Straight, parallel lines scored along the length of the loaf encourage expansion in a specific direction.

  • Angled Scoring: Angled scores, intersecting at the center of the loaf, promote even expansion in multiple directions.

  • Cross-Hatch Scoring: A combination of straight and angled scores, creating a crosshatch pattern, helps prevent the loaf from tearing and ensures an even expansion.

Care and Maintenance of Bread Lames: Preserving Sharpness

Regular Cleaning: The Key to Hygiene

After each use, thoroughly clean your bread lame with hot water and dish soap. Pay attention to any crevices where dough or grime may accumulate.

Drying: Essential for Rust Prevention

After cleaning, immediately dry your lame with a clean towel to prevent rust. This is especially important for carbon steel blades, which are more prone to oxidation.

Lubrication: Keeping the Blade Smooth

Periodically lubricate the blade with a food-grade oil, such as mineral oil or olive oil. This reduces friction and ensures a smooth cut.

Sharpening: Maintaining Precision

Regular sharpening is crucial to maintain the blade’s sharpness. Use a fine-grain sharpening stone or diamond hone to gently hone the edge.

Storage: Safeguarding Your Lame

When not in use, store your bread lame in a dry place to prevent rust and damage. Consider using a protective case or wrapping the blade in a soft cloth.

Safety Measures When Using Bread Lames

Bread lames are sharp tools, so it’s important to take safety precautions when using them. Here are some tips to help you stay safe:

1. Always use a sharp blade

A dull blade will require more force to cut through the dough, which can increase the risk of slipping and injuring yourself. Make sure to sharpen your blade regularly.

2. Grip the handle securely

Use a firm, steady grip on the handle to prevent the blade from slipping.

3. Cut away from your body

Always cut away from your body to avoid injuring yourself if the blade slips.

4. Keep your fingers away from the blade

Always keep your fingers well away from the blade, even when you’re not cutting.

5. Store the lame safely

When you’re not using the lame, store it safely out of reach of children and pets.

6. Wear gloves to avoid cuts and scrapes

If you are concerned about cutting yourself, wear gloves when using bread lames.

7. Inspect the blade before each use

Check the blade for any damage before each use. If the blade is damaged, do not use it as it could break and cause injury.

8. Keep the blade clean

Always clean the blade after each use to prevent the buildup of bacteria.

9. Be aware of your surroundings

Make sure you are in a well-lit area and that there is no one in the way when you are using a bread lame.
